WebThe 2024 Year 1 Phonics Screening Check was undertaken in 1,643 NSW Government schools, with 65,045 Year 1 students participating and completing the assessment (96.1% of the total number of Year 1 students across the testing window). 1. The Year 1 Phonics Screening Check consisted . of 40 items. The average number of items . correct was 26.

WebThe Phonics Screening Check is an assessment to check a child’s ability to read words using phonics rules. This is the school’s first formal way of checking your child’s phonics progress and helps the school show the overall progress of children in Year 1.
